The Haagse Bos is a small neighbourhood with just 460 residents, mostly over 45. It is one of the most urban areas in the city, yet the park of the same name is just a five-minute walk away. There are no neighbourhood reviews available for this area.
For daily groceries, you have SPAR express, SPAR and Albert Heijn all within a ten-minute walk. Primary schools are a bit further, Basisschool Essesteijn is about 2 km away, while secondary schools like Veurs Voorburg are closer. Haagse Bos is a very small, quiet neighbourhood with mostly older residents. It is densely built but right next to a large park. There are few families with children, and most households are single-person.
The nearest train station is 1.1 km away, about a 14-minute walk.
SPAR express is 921 m away, SPAR 935 m, and Albert Heijn 956 m, all within a ten-minute walk.
Yes, several primary and secondary schools are within 2,2.5 km, including Basisschool Essesteijn and Veurs Voorburg.
The neighbourhood recorded 122 total crimes, which is moderate for such a dense urban area.
